Overview
This is the Western Kentucky University (Kentucky) Baseball scholarship and program information page. Here you can explore important information about Western Kentucky University Baseball. This information is very valuable for all high school student-athletes to understand as they start the recruiting process. Western Kentucky University is located in Bowling Green, KY and the Baseball program competes in the Conference USA conference.
Western Kentucky University does offer athletic scholarships for Baseball. Need-based and academic scholarships are available for student-athletes. Athletic scholarships are available for NCAA Division I, NCAA Division II, NAIA and NJCAA. On average, 34% of all student-athletes receive athletic scholarships.
